A very simple but very popular model for nuclear multifragmentation is this: the nucleus is heated up and breaks up into many pieces (composites and new produced particles if the energy is sufficient) strictly according to phase space. This occurs in an expanded volume, about three or four times the normal volume. Population strictly according to phase-space implies chemical and thermal equilib...

Paragangliomas are rare neuroendocrine tumors that may arise anywhere along the paraganglial system, with a high frequency of hereditary forms or multifocal disease. Most often, paragangliomas are benign and progress slowly, but metastases may occur in about 10% of patients.
